During the initial two years, you'll explore various subjects spanning essential pure and applied mathematics concepts, with no prerequisites regarding prior mechanics, statistics, or computer experience. First-year modules ensure all students reach the same foundational level, building on core principles and strengthening A-level knowledge.
This program additionally features a study abroad year, presenting an exceptional chance to spend an academic term at one of our affiliated international institutions.

Qualification Requirements

A levels
ABB
Applicants with the Extended Project Qualification (EPQ) are eligible for a reduction in grade requirements. For this course, the offer is ABC with A in the EPQ.
BTEC Level 3 National Extended Diploma
D*DD in relevant diploma, when combined with A Level Mathematics grade A
International Baccalaureate
33 including 6 in Higher Mathematics.
Irish Leaving Certificate H1, H2, H2, H2, H3, H3 including Mathematics at H1.

toefl - Minimum 78 overall with L 17 W 17 R 17 and S 19
ielts - Overall IELTS 6.0, no less than 5.5 in component scores
